A Brief History of Jaguar

To appreciate Jaguar today, one should take a step back into its history. Founded in 1922, originally as the Swallow Sidecar Company, it transitioned to Jaguar in 1945. Throughout the decades, the brand has been synonymous with British engineering excellence. The rise of Jaguar’s reputation came with iconic models like the XK120 in the 1950s, a car that not only turned heads but also broke speed records.

Over the years, Jaguar has carved out a niche in the automotive world by blending performance with elegance. The 1960s saw the introduction of the E-Type, often hailed as one of the most beautiful cars ever made. From racing to luxury, Jaguar’s journey paints a rich picture of innovation and resilience. Understanding this lineage is essential for potential buyers, as it provides context about the brand’s dedication to quality and performance.

Understanding Depreciation in Luxury Vehicles

Depreciation in luxury vehicles often follows a predictable path. New cars can lose a significant portion of their value within the first few years. For Jaguar, this can be particularly pronounced due to its status as a luxury brand. Once the initial excitement wears off, many luxury vehicles face a steep decline in their market price.

It’s vital to understand this pricing dynamic. Here’s how it typically works:

  • Initial Drop: A brand-new Jaguar may lose up to 30% of its value within the first year. This makes buying used tremendously appealing for buyers who wish to dodge the steepest drop.
  • Gradual Decrease: After the first few years, depreciation slows down but still continues. Buyers can often find models that are just a few years old for substantially less than their MSRP.
  • Stability Over Time: Once a vehicle hits a certain age, its value stabilizes. This often applies to models that have become classics in their own right among enthusiasts.

Jaguar X-Type Overview

The Jaguar X-Type is often regarded as an entry-level luxury sedan within the Jaguar lineup. Launched in 2001, it was designed to appeal to a broader audience, providing the elegance and performance typical of the brand without breaking the bank. The X-Type features a compact design, which is quite distinct from its siblings, making it ideal for urban driving where maneuverability is key.

A few points to consider:

  • Engine Options: The X-Type offers a variety of engine choices, including a 2.5-liter V6 and a 3.0-liter V6. These engines have decent power and fuel efficiency, appealing to drivers looking for a balance between performance and economy.
  • All-Wheel Drive Availability: Many X-Types come equipped with an all-wheel-drive system, providing enhanced traction, especially in poor weather conditions, which is a notable advantage in regions with variable climates.
  • Interior Space and Features: The interior is adorned with quality materials, offering a comfortable experience for both driver and passengers. Though it may not be as spacious as other luxury sedans, it compensates with its upscale atmosphere.

Jaguar S-Type Characteristics

The Jaguar S-Type, produced from 1999 to 2008, encapsulates the classic Jaguar aesthetics while packing robust engineering. This model serves as a step up from the X-Type, making it attractive to those seeking more luxury and technological advancements.

Key characteristics include:

  • Design and Luxury: With its retro styling, the S-Type commands attention on the road. The luxurious leather seats and wood accents create an inviting environment, complementing the driving experience.
  • Driving Experience: The S-Type often features a 3.0-liter V6 or a more potent 4.2-liter V8, delivering a gratifying performance that enthusiasts appreciate. The handling is precise, akin to what you'd expect from a sports sedan.
  • Technology and Amenities: This model is outfitted with a range of tech options, from navigation systems to premium audio setups that elevate everyday commuting to something more enjoyable.

Jaguar XK Series Insights

The Jaguar XK series is a different beast altogether, offering a blend of sporty performance and convertible bliss. Launched in 1996, the XK series includes both coupe and convertible versions, merging luxury and functionality. However, it may slightly stretch the budget when purchasing used but is significant to consider if you find a well-maintained model at a good price.

Some insights are:

  • Performance and Handling: The XK series is known for its powerful engines, and handles exceptionally well thanks to its lightweight aluminum construction. Driving one evokes a thrill few other vehicles offer, making it a joy for any driving enthusiast.
  • Timeless Design: The sleek and aerodynamic shape of the XK makes it an eye-catcher. Its timeless identity ensures that it still looks modern even years after its release.
  • Maintenance and Parts: It's important to have a grasp on potential maintenance costs for the XK series, as they can require a bit more attention. Ensuring that you know what to look out for in terms of wear and tear is vital.

Evaluating Condition and Mileage

The condition of the Jaguar is paramount. A shiny exterior might catch the eye, but digging deeper is essential. Start with a close inspection of the body for any rust, dents, or scratches, as these can indicate a rough history. Look under the hood; the heart of the car should be clean and well-maintained. Check the engine oil and coolant levels to ensure there's no leak and that the fluids are as they should be.

Mileage plays a significant role too. Generally, the rule of thumb is that the lower, the better. However, a car with higher mileage that has been meticulously maintained can outperform a lower-mileage model that has seen neglect. For instance, a well-cared-for Jaguar with 80,000 miles might be a better buy than one with only 50,000 miles that faced several tough service intervals with less care.

Checking Service History

A used Jaguar’s service history is like a report card. A comprehensive record of maintenance, including oil changes and any repairs, reflects how much a previous owner valued the vehicle. Find out if major services, like timing belt replacements, have been done on schedule.

Looking for a car that has frequent visits to trusted professionals can indicate a commitment to its upkeep. Any records indicating major repairs or accidents are also red flags to consider. A vehicle history report can be extremely useful here. Services like Carfax or AutoCheck can provide vital information pertaining to the car’s history, ensuring buyers aren’t walking into a money pit.

Understanding Previous Ownership

Previous ownership can reveal a lot about the used Jaguar's life. If the car has changed hands multiple times, it might hint at underlying issues. Ideally, the fewer owners, the better, as this suggests stability and loyalty to the vehicle.

It's helpful to know who owned the car. Someone who treasured the luxury experience, maintaining the Jaguar like it's a crown jewel, is likely to have cared more than someone who saw it as just another ride. Furthermore, check if the previous owners participated in any clubs or forums—like www.reddit.com/r/Jaguars—where enthusiasts discuss maintenance tips or common issues related to specific models.

Common Maintenance Issues in Used Jaguars

Used Jaguars, like any high-performance vehicle, come with their own unique set of maintenance challenges. Some of the most common issues that owners might face include:

  • Electrical System Problems: Jaguars are known for their intricate electrical systems which can lead to issues ranging from malfunctioning sensors to faulty wiring. It’s not uncommon for these models to exhibit quirks such as erratic dashboard signals or failure in electronic window operation.
  • Cooling System Failures: Overheating can be a problem, particularly in older models. Hoses and radiators may display wear and tear, leading to potential leaks. Regular checks can prevent severe damage from occurring.
  • Suspension Wear: Many Jaguar models feature sophisticated suspension systems that provide great handling. However, these systems can wear out, leading to a rough ride or decreased handling capabilities.
  • Transmission Issues: The transmission is crucial for performance, and any sign of slipping or strange noises should prompt an immediate inspection.
  • Routine Maintenance Neglect: Unfortunately, some previous owners may overlook the importance of routine service checks. It’s key to ensure that oil changes, filter replacements, and fluid levels are consistently managed, or else you may find yourself heading for costly repairs down the line.

A thorough inspection by a knowledgeable mechanic can reveal a lot about the health of any used Jaguar and potentially save a buyer from unexpected costs.

Owning a luxury vehicle like a Jaguar means that costs associated with repairs and parts can be a bit steeper than the average vehicle. Here are some insights into the financial aspects:

  • Cost of Parts: Genuine parts for Jaguars often come with a premium price tag. For example, a simple brake pad replacement can set you back significantly compared to non-luxury brands. In some cases, sourcing parts from specialized suppliers can alleviate costs, but one might compromise on authenticity.
  • Labor Costs: While labor rates can vary based on location and shop reputation, expect to pay a higher hourly rate at a dealership, often in the $100 to $150 range. Specialized shops may offer slight discounts if they have the right equipment to handle luxury repairs.
  • Scheduled Maintenance: Jaguar recommends specific service intervals that keep the vehicle operating smoothly. These can include major checks at around 10,000 miles, 30,000 miles, and so forth. Budgeting for these scheduled maintenance visits is essential for any prospective owner.

In general, potential buyers should expect to allocate a substantial budget not just for the purchase, but also for long-term upkeep. Being proactive about maintenance will ensure that you enjoy a luxury experience without the added anxiety of unforeseen repairs.
